American actress Heather Matarazzo was BOTD in 1982. Born and raised in New York City, she began acting aged six, and found an agent after commandeering the microphone at an HIV/AIDS benefit. She made a spectacular film debut in Todd Solondz‘s 1995 indie film Welcome to the Dollhouse, playing Dawn Wiener, a plain, perennially victimised middle-schooler navigating the horrors of suburban adolescence, winning her an Independent Spirit Award. Her other films include The Devil’s Advocate, Scream 3, The Princess Diaries and Hostel Part II. She came out publicly as lesbian when she was 21, starting (inevitably) in Sapphic TV series The L Word. She portrayed lesbian activist (and birthday twin) Phyllis Lyon in the 2020 docudrama Equal, and had a supporting role as a lesbian raising a child with her gay best friend in the 2023 film The Mattachine Family. Matarazzo lives in New York with her wife Heather Truman.
